During the Collaborate 16, Jeb Dasteel, Chief Customer Officer Oracle Corporation, invited Stefan Kinnen as representative of DOAG to a Executive Roundtable. Reason is the announcement of the program “Oracle Accelerated Buying Experience” that completely rebuilds and simplifies the whole entire purchasing process and basic contracts.
Oracle has realized that their contract work is too complicated and out of date in the age of cloud computing. The scope of the contracts partly leads to multiple iterative interactions with the customers, which delayed the actual statements by several weeks or months. This is no longer acceptable, mentioned also the CEO Board and is ready for surprisingly significant changes. „If other cloud providers summarize their contract work in a few pages and validate it worldwide and simple, Oracle might do it as well“, summarizes Jeb Dasteel the motivation and mentioned that he has rarely experienced such deep changes during his long Oracle career. Up to a „1-click service“ for buyings up to about 100.000$ everything will become easier.
“DOAG welcomes these changes by Oracle, especially regarding the frequently discussed issues in relation to European or national adaptions in the past”, says Stefan Kinnen. “Individual agreements are good and important – a simpler contract base in conjunction with accelerated processes in the financial statements will lead to more transparency and less blockages. We are looking forward and are excited about the results that can be expected in the period June/July.”
